#378735 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#378735 is composed of 21.6% red, 52.9%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.7%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 118.5 degrees, a saturation of 43.6% and a lightness of 36.9%. #378735 color hex could be obtained by blending #6eff6a with #000f00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#378735 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#378735 has RGB values of R:55, G:135,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 3639093.

Shades and Tints of #378735
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030803 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#378735
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#596359 is the less saturated color, while #07ba02 is the most saturated one.
